CLSA Premium Ltd (HKG:6877), formerly KVB Kunlun, and Beijing Tong Ren Tang (Cayman) Limited (TRT International), a forex broker, have signed a strategic partnership agreement to expand healthcare businesses (including Chinese medicine).

The collaboration will involve, among other things:
TRT International will provide technical help to the Company in the areas of healthcare product specialization, procurement channel, product development, and Chinese medicine application.
TRT International will give training to the company on the healthcare industry and Chinese medicine.
TRT International will second employees with healthcare expertise to the company.
Network-building - The Company and TRT International will reciprocally introduce their networks and individuals in the healthcare industry (including Chinese medicine) to improve, among other things, network building.
Further Partnership - Subject to the evolution of healthcare business collaboration and market circumstances, the Company and TRT International may evaluate potential or reciprocal investment or assistance to each other.
The license to sell Chinese medicines - Given that the Group has a wholesaler license in proprietary Chinese medicines, it shall offer appropriate support and a route to TRT International for TRT International to distribute Chinese medicines in the Greater China area.
“The Board believes that entering into the Strategic Cooperation Agreement would enable the Group to leverage on the expertise of the TRT International group for expanding the modular management and expansion of healthcare products businesses (including Chinese medicine), and would play a positive role in diversifying the Group's revenue stream,” CLSA Premium said.
CLSA Premium Ltd, originally KVB Kunlun Financial Group Ltd, is an investment holding firm that specializes in leveraged foreign exchange, commodities, and index trading.

This WEALTH-FX review starts with a licensing statement that needs verification. The client agreement on wealth-fx.com says the company is incorporated in St. Vincent and the Grenadines as 88102 LLC 2021 and is authorised and regulated by the SVG FSA. An official SVG FSA notice, however, says forex trading brokerage activities are not licensed in that jurisdiction. The same agreement separately names WealthFX Liquidity Limited, company 180782, and describes a Mauritius International License. For an India-based reader, those website claims do not replace RBI rules for permitted forex transactions or an independently confirmed licence record.

FCA warns EXOTICINVEST in a notice first published and updated on 3 September 2026. The UK regulator identifies EXOTICINVEST TRADING AND INVESTMENT FIRM and the website www.exoticinvest.ltd, stating that the firm is not authorised and may be targeting people in the UK. This is a dated regulatory warning, not a customer review or a confirmed loss report. Anyone approached through the named website should stop before paying, avoid sharing login credentials and verify the exact business independently through the FCA Firm Checker.
